My husband is trying to quit after years of smoking and is doing quite well - down to 3-4 a day. He has started munching on sunflower seeds which has helped throughout the day. Although they are healthy in many regards they are also pretty high in fat and he doesnt want to end up eating an entire bag each day (or have to run an extra thousand miles to burn them all off). I read a post that suggested frozen grapes which is a fantastic idea and much healthier but so any of you have any other suggestions? We tried carrot sticks but he got sick of them too quickly. I've been smoke free for just over 2 years now (15 year smoker). That's great about your husband! I found drinking lots and lots of water helped. I always had something in my hand, normally a pen just to keep my hands busy. I ate sugar free candies, carrots, celery and tons of gum (which I'm still totally dependent on). Good luck!
